OPPO Find X2 Pro is a bit better than the Asus ZenFone 8, with a general score of 83.1 against 83. Both phones in this review have Android OS (Operating System), but OPPO Find X2 Pro has 10 version and Asus ZenFone 8 has Android 11. The OPPO Find X2 Pro body has the same thickness than the Asus ZenFone 8, but it's heavier.
The OPPO Find X2 Pro has a little bit better screen than Asus ZenFone 8, because although it has a lot darker display, it also counts with a better resolution of 1440 x 3168 pixels, a bit higher count of pixels per inch in the screen and a bit bigger display. The OPPO Find X2 Pro has a bit more powerful processor than Asus ZenFone 8, and although they both have a Octa-Core processing unit, the OPPO Find X2 Pro also has more RAM memory.
Asus ZenFone 8 features a slightly better camera than OPPO Find X2 Pro, because although it has a smaller camera aperture which is not favorable for low-light photos and a smaller back-facing camera sensor shooting lower quality photographs, it also counts with a lot higher 7680x4320 video resolution and a camera in the back with much more mega pixels.
OPPO Find X2 Pro has a very superior storage for applications and games than Asus ZenFone 8, because it has 384 GB more internal memory. OPPO Find X2 Pro counts with just a bit better battery lifetime than Asus ZenFone 8, because it has a 7% more battery capacity.
